GLP-1 receptor agonists are a cutting-edge class of medications primarily used to manage type 2 diabetes. However, growing research suggests their potential uses extend beyond blood sugar control, impacting appetite regulation and promoting reduced body mass. When incorporated into a well-planned diet, these agonists can materially optimize your dietary methods for improved health outcomes.
- Utilizing limited portions can be facilitated by the appetite-suppressing effects of GLP-1 agonists, leading to a natural reduction in calorie intake.
- Adjusting your macronutrient profile with higher protein and decreased carbohydrates can synergize with the metabolic effects of these drugs for optimal results.
- Recording your food intake and fine-tuning your diet based on your individual response to the medication is crucial for personalized success.

Healthy Eating Tips for GLP-1 Users
Embarking on GLP-1 therapy can be a transformative journey in your health management. To maximize its efficacy, it's crucial to pair this medication with a well-planned, healthy diet.
- Focus on nutrient-rich foods like fruits, vegetables, lean protein, and whole grains.
- Stay hydrated throughout the day.
- Reduce your consumption of processed foods, sugary drinks, and unhealthy fats.
- Pay attention to serving sizes to avoid overeating.
- Talk to a registered dietitian or healthcare professional for personalized meal planning advice.
By implementing these guidelines, you can maximize the results of your GLP-1 therapy and work towards a healthier lifestyle.
